About The Position

As an Inside Sales Representative within WWT, you will have the ability to work within a high-performing team including Client Managers, Sales Engineers and Service Sales Reps to truly own the full scope of business and understand WWT’s customer and business needs. The ability to realize and master the full quote to cash process will provide great value to WWT and the many verticals in which Inside Sales operates. The clearly defined career path within Inside Sales, as well as their excellent organizational leadership, makes this role a great opportunity to excel in a customer-facing aspect within the ever-growing IT field, both domestically and internationally.

Requirements

  • B.A., Business, Finance or other related field or equivalent work experience within the IT industry
  • Minimum of two years sales or sales support experience in the information technology industry
  • Proficient PC Skills (MS Office Suite)
  • Ability to effectively utilize WWT internal systems, tools and processes
  • Demonstrated leadership, communication and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to travel as required meeting team and departmental goals (<25%)

Responsibilities

  • Initiate and provide day-to-day support of all quoting and order management activities within assigned accounts
  • Strong working knowledge of key internal systems and processes, in-depth knowledge of our go-to-market strategy as well as partner facing applications and promotions that allow us to competitively source products and services
  • Accurately respond to customer requirements within the stated time frames (requests for quotes, order processing, product information, order tracking details)
  • Proactively build and maintain a strong working knowledge of assigned accounts
  • Proactively build and maintain a strong working knowledge of strategic OEM products and services
  • In-depth knowledge and use of WWT tools, processes and partner-facing applications to build and validate technical configurations
  • Working knowledge of Direct and Indirect sources of supply and associated quote and order processes
  • Proactively leverage product promotions and rebate incentives
  • Working knowledge of the partner registration process
  • Ability to recognize an opportunity to upsell or attach services
  • Proactively provide detailed quote and order management reports to key stakeholders
  • Assist, mentor, and onboard new sales ops employees
